In this course, we would like to take a different approach to all the other industry training on the subject, and present a practical workflow on how to build a gemodel that can be effectively used for reservoir simulation. We emphasize the practical application of the geomodel for business decisions over the complicated geology or latest software advancements. We go through an entire process of building a geomodel and review multiple case studies for all major depositional environments. A strong emphasis is made on capturing uncertainty at every step of the geomodelling workflow. There is a healthy split between the presentation and exercise parts of the course and all the information presented is directly applicable to your day-to-day activities as a reservoir modeller.

Who Should Attend?

Geologists, Geophysicists, Petrophysicists, and Engineers who wish to develop a better understanding of building a static reservoir model that is used for hydrocarbon volume estimation and reservoir simulation in development planning.

Course Outcomes

Delegates will gain knowledge and skills to:

  • The input data used to build a static reservoir geomodel
  • How to build a structural frame for the geomodel
  • How to divide the reservoir into depositional blocks
  • How to distribute porosity, permeability and saturation with geology in mind
  • How to evaluate the uncertainty of the resulting geomodel
  • How to effectively hand over the static geomodel to be used for simulation

Key Course Highlights

  • You are going to build a practical skillset, without being overloaded with theory
  • We are going to cover case studies for building geomodels for all major depositional environments
  • Multiple exercises for almost every step of the model building workflow
  • Emphasis on learning to build a geomodel that reservoir engineers can effectively use for simulation studies
  • The course is software independent. The information presented can be applied to any model building software package.
